V/A Druid’s Potion vol.1 [Mandragore Records]

Druid Potion is a 100% frenchy newcomers compilation focusing on uplifting full on, it’s also the first release from the new french parisian Mandragore label hold by Jyppé from Tranceshop.com (Trance french site, not to confund with Trance-Shop the online shop from Germany).

Tracklist :

1. Stimulus ft Dj Kzymodo – Atomic Experience

Stimulus (Fred Kiszon) ft Dj Kzymodo (Seb Manson) begins with an aquatic intro through an harp melody (that will come back later on). A charm provocated in few seconds & remaining all along. For the rest, the atmosphere is smelling like is very springish.

2. Rasti – Slapback

Rasti (Jean Salomon) keep going this way with bouncy & brisk sounds. If you’re into bicycle you’ll be fond of the intro & outro. The bassline is Zébulon-ish (Zébulon is a little character always jumping everywhere near a merry-go-round in a french old well known program for child ‘Le manège enchanté‘. It means that Slapback got a calm morning atmosphere which sometimes get facetious, so it results a cross between oniric & childish emotionnal feeling here.


3. Crystal Visions – Nocturn Activity

Crystal Vision (Frédéric Kiszon aka Stimulus + Alexandre Joly) makes you penetrate into a more usual full on dimension, consequently dancefloor. Kicks are more pushed, sounds are clear but less original compared to the 2 previous stuffs. Nocturn Activity reveals itself an effective full on producion without being revolutionary.

4. Shagma – Big One

Shagma (Laurent Fassier aka Fasspot + Jean Salomon aka Rasti) is still on the dancefloor full on way with an intro a la ‘Morphem-Hypnotone’, i mean an old crooner 10 seconds while his voice gets detuned like if he was deflating. So except the intro, it’s a typical squeaking full on stuff in a C.P.U style.
You are enjoying melodic, twisted, energic & muscular full on, Big One will suit you.

5. Phonic Request – Martyre

Phonic Request (Wilfried Decaesteker) enters a dryer, matter full on register. The aim of Martyre is a psychotic trip according to me dredged with some few psychedelic tones, so it could result much more difficult to catch for most of you. Don’t be afraid if your first listening don’t satisfyed you, let’s give it another chance & it could only improve your perception of the tune.



6. Polypheme ft Moon Sphynx – Spider Sens

Polypheme (Christophe Donna aka Dj Cyclope ) ft Moon Sphynx (Laure Moreno aka Dj Miss Jump) have built a
throbbing groove fullonish stuff. I’m not fan of the lead, otherwise the musical tone is quite mat. I think the artists have tryed to develop a climatic production, unfortunatly for me the goal is only partially achieved due to a certain lack of depht & amplitude in sounds, harmonies & rythmic. Nevertheless Spider Sens would deserve to be auto-remixed or get a new lifted version, only good things could result from that.


7. Magnetik Fusion ft Lady Arwen – Move Your Ass To Mars

Magnetik Fusion (Jean Christophe Perrin) ft Lady Arwen (Eléonore Saumur) tackle an hypnotic whirling trance way (the whirling side only happens after 3’00) in Move Your Ass To Mars. Percussions can be noticed around 5’00 in order to increase the hypnotical power, closely followed at 5’15 with a shrill lead which will mute into 303 loops just after & during a very short time. Indeed the construction, the rising up & the quick etheral final reminds mea lot ‘Trancition’ from Chocci & the Freedom Of Sound (acidtrance song from 1992) ; corrosive night full on lovers with rising in stages will be delighted.

8. United Spirit – De Esser

United Spirit (Emmanuel Scaillierez) contarily to other artist on this compilation got a proper sound, even if we can admitt some virtual influences in the fat electric guitar from Tim Schuldt. The spirit of the tune is more muffled, subtle, floating by moment & simply musical therefore i’m convinced people will prefer easier production from Crystal Visions & Shagma from this compilation.

9. Shadow Wax – Phénopsychedelik

Shadow Wax (Laurent Caffin) evoluates in the night full on sphere, the atmosphere is foggy & scheming. A soound half synth, half female voice closes in on us from beginning & after 1’50, like a physical intererior call which would doze in you. Phénopsychedelik bolts a bit from that point, elements are going faster & begin to swarm. From 5’00 a more twangy synth arrives, that’s a pity as it breaks a bit the charm on the final ; though the tune is still remaining very trippy.


Highlights by order:2,1,9,7
Then : 4,3,8,5,6

7/10 Wishing that numerous vol will follow this first Druid’s Potion & that Mandragore will keep helping french or whatever country origin newcomers to get their first tracks released on a label.
